Learning Disabilities: Attention Deficit Hyperactivity Disorder (ADHD)


Introduction

All over the world today, there are children and adults with significant problems in four main areas of their lives:
Inattention, Impulsivity, Hyperactivity, Boredom.

The ratio of the human population having these problems, can be statistically measured as for 5 out of ever 100 children in school. Although the male tend to outnumber the female by 3 to 1 in prevalence of attaining this disorder.

 

These people will exhibit problems in concentration, learning and memory as their problems involves a person’s ability to process and sort out incoming information or stimulus, both internally and externally.

While it is not classified a specific learning disability, it can interfere with concentration and attention, making it difficult for a person to do well in school and in social situations.
